What Is A Doona Car Seat?

A Doona car seat is a revolutionary infant car seat designed to provide convenience and versatility for parents on the go. Unlike traditional car seats, the Doona integrates seamlessly with a stroller. It offers a two-in-one solution for transporting babies.

The innovative design allows parents to effortlessly transition between car seat and stroller modes with just a simple click of a button. It eliminates the need for separate equipment and reduces hassle. Life will get easier for you.

The Doona car seat features a compact and lightweight design. It is ideal for urban environments, travel, and everyday use. Besides, it is equipped with side-impact protection, adjustable harnesses, and a secure five-point harness system.

Furthermore, the Doona car seat is rigorously tested and compliant with safety standards. It provides parents with peace of mind knowing that their child is secure and protected. The ergonomic design ensures comfort for both the baby and the caregiver.

What Is The Weight Limit For Doona Car Seat?

The weight limit for the Doona car seat varies depending on its configuration and intended use. As a car seat, the weight limit typically ranges between 4 to 35 pounds (1.8 to 15.9 kilograms). This weight limit ensures that the car seat provides optimal safety and support for infants during car rides.

Additionally, when the Doona car seat is used as a stroller, it typically has a slightly higher weight limit. The stroller weight limit often extends up to around 30 pounds (13.6 kilograms) or more. This flexibility allows parents to continue using the Doona as a stroller even after their child outgrows the car seat configuration.

Still, it is essential for parents to check the specific weight limit guidelines provided by the manufacturer. Exceeding weight limits can compromise the effectiveness of the car seat’s safety features and increase the risk of injury in the event of a collision or accident.

Why Is There A Weight Limit For Doona Car Seat?

The weight limit for the Doona car seat is crucial for ensuring the safety, effectiveness, and longevity of the product. Several key reasons underlie the necessity for weight limits. Some of the common ones are shared down below for you.

Safety Standards Compliance

Car seats are subjected to rigorous safety testing and certification requirements. Weight limits are established based on these safety standards to ensure that the car seat provides adequate protection and support for infants within a specific weight range.

Structural Integrity

The design and construction of the car seat are optimized to accommodate infants within a certain weight range. Exceeding the weight limit can strain the structural integrity of the car seat. Following the weight limit helps maintain the car seat’s stability and performance.

Comfort and Ergonomics

Car seats are designed to provide optimal comfort and support for infants during car rides. Parents can ensure that their child remains comfortable and properly positioned within the car seat by following the weight limit for Doona car seat. Minimize discomfort and promote safer travel experiences.
